Oejangdeogam Lighthouse

Fl (2) W 5s🇰🇷Tongyeong Area, KROperational

This black beacon, distinguished by red banding, stands 46 meters tall. Its light has a focal height of 18 meters above sea level. The characteristic of the light is two white flashes that repeat every 5 seconds. The lighthouse is operational and has a geographic range of 10 nautical miles. It is located in the Tongyeong Area.

Which ports and harbors does Oejangdeogam Lighthouse guide vessels into?+
Oejangdeogam Lighthouse assists vessels approaching 5 nearby ports. The closest is Junghwa at 7.7 NM to the N. Other ports served include Kukdo (8.7 NM SSE), Tongyeong (11.4 NM NNE), Geoje (16.6 NM NE), GOSEONG (17.7 NM N). Mariners should consult the relevant chart for full approach and pilotage information.
